#5aefd2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5aefd2 is composed of 35.3% red, 93.7%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 12.1%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 168.3 degrees, a saturation of 82.3% and a lightness of 64.5%. #5aefd2 color hex could be obtained by blending #b4ffff with #00dfa5.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

#5aefd2 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#5aefd2 has RGB values of R:90, G:239,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0, Y:0.12,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 5959634.

Shades and Tints of #5aefd2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010e0b is the darkest color, while #fbfff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#5aefd2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a0a9a7 is the less saturated color, while #4cfddb is the most saturated one.
